## Releases

Pingquill releases are cut from `main` on Tuesdays. Tag the commit, run `make release`, and the bot image builds automatically. The status-reporting bot must be able to push deploy notices to the Hollowmere chat cluster, so the release artifact is signed before publishing. Version numbers follow plain semver; no release candidates. The artifact must be signed with the release key, which is listed below.

rollout seal: bky4_x7Gc

## Ownership

The TilePlow prefetcher is a bit of a beast — it guesses which map tiles you'll pan to next and warms the cache ahead of time. The heuristics live in `predictor/`, and yes, they're fragile; read the comments before touching anything. For design questions or merge approvals, ping the maintainer listed below.

named custodian: Brivan Eliath Quenox Frador

### Step 4: Apply remediation config

Per the Quillhaven stale-cache postmortem, the old invalidation settings allowed entries to outlive their source records by hours. Before promoting build 14.2, replace the cache tier's config with the corrected values below. Do not merge with existing overrides; the postmortem traced the bug to a partial override. Verify all three regions restart cleanly, then sign off in the release tracker. The corrected configuration to apply is as follows.

config for faweg-yajef:
DRUIX_HOST=druix.lumicsys.internal
DRUIX_PORT=9000

## Contractor Access — First Week

Contractors at Veldrane Works report to the north lobby, Harrowfield site. Day one: sign in, collect a temporary lanyard, complete the safety briefing before 10:00. Days two through five: use the contractor turnstile only. Do not tailgate. Escort required in Building C. Lost passes incur a replacement fee. After your briefing is logged, the following pass code unlocks the contractor entrance.

door code, yagap-bahof: bdg-O-05

- [ ] Step 7: Archive cold storage buckets (Glacierline tier). Confirm both ceremony witnesses are present, verify bucket manifests match the Oxbow ledger, then seal the archive key shares. Plugin authors may observe but not handle shares. Once sealed, the archive index itself is encrypted and can only be reopened with the passphrase below.

vault phrase of badup-hahig = tamael-aldael-kelmir-istael-fenok-istwyn-tamius-jorath-oliion